Engine |
|
Engine type | gas / petrol |
Engine capacity, cm³ | 1598 |
Boost type | No |
Maximum power, hp/kW at rpm | 94 / 69 at 6000 |
Maximum torque, N*m at rpm | 150 at 3900 |
Cylinder arrangement | in-line |
Number of cylinders | 4 |
Number of valves per cylinder | 4 |
Engine power supply system | distributed injection |
Compression ratio | 10 |
Cylinder diameter and piston stroke, mm | 79 × 81.5 |
General information |
|
Brand country | Germany |
Car class | C |
Number of doors | 5 |
Performance indicators |
|
Ecological class | Euro 4 |
Security |
|
Safety assessment | 5 |
Rating name | Euro NCAP |
Sizes in mm |
|
Length | 4249 |
Width | 1753 |
Height | 1460 |
Wheelbase | 2614 |
Ground clearance | 165 |
Front track width | 1488 |
Rear track width | 1488 |
Wheel size | 195 / 65 / R15 |
Suspension and brakes |
|
Type of front suspension | independent, spring |
Type of rear suspension | independent, spring |
Front brakes | disk ventilated |
Rear brakes | disc |
Transmission |
|
Transmission | mechanical |
Number of gears | 5 |
Drive type | front |
Volume and weight |
|
Fuel tank capacity, l | 52 |
Curb weight, kg | 1265 |
Trunk volume min/max, l | 350 / 1270 |
Gross weight, kg | 1740 |
The Opel Astra, a well-known name in the compact car segment, has been a favorite among drivers for its blend of practicality, reliability, and affordability. The 2004-2006 Opel Astra 1.6 MT (94 hp) is a five-door hatchback that offers a balanced mix of performance and efficiency, making it an excellent choice for urban commuting and long-distance travel alike. With its German engineering and Euro 4 compliance, this model stands out as a dependable option in the C-class category.
Under the hood, the Opel Astra 1.6 MT is powered by a 1.6-liter inline-four petrol engine, delivering 94 horsepower at 6000 rpm and 150 Nm of torque at 3900 rpm. This naturally aspirated engine is paired with a 5-speed manual transmission, providing a smooth and engaging driving experience. While it may not be the most powerful engine in its class, it offers sufficient performance for daily driving, with a focus on fuel efficiency and reliability. The front-wheel-drive setup ensures stable handling, making it a practical choice for both city streets and highways.
The Astra's design is both functional and stylish, with a length of 4249 mm, a width of 1753 mm, and a height of 1460 mm. Its compact dimensions make it easy to maneuver in tight spaces, while the 2614 mm wheelbase ensures a comfortable ride for passengers. The hatchback body style offers versatility, with a trunk capacity ranging from 350 liters to an impressive 1270 liters when the rear seats are folded down. This makes it an ideal choice for families or individuals who need extra cargo space.
The Opel Astra features an independent spring suspension system on both the front and rear, providing a balanced and comfortable ride. The ventilated front disc brakes and rear disc brakes ensure reliable stopping power, even in challenging driving conditions. With a ground clearance of 165 mm, the Astra handles uneven roads with ease, making it suitable for a variety of driving environments.
Safety is a strong suit for the Opel Astra, as evidenced by its 5-star Euro NCAP rating. The car is equipped with advanced safety features, including driver and passenger airbags, ABS, and a robust body structure designed to absorb impact. Additionally, the Astra meets the Euro 4 emission standards, making it an environmentally friendly choice for eco-conscious drivers.
The Opel Astra 1.6 MT (94 hp) is a well-rounded hatchback that excels in practicality, safety, and efficiency. While it may lack the power and modern amenities of newer models, its reliability, spacious interior, and excellent safety record make it a compelling choice for budget-conscious buyers. Whether you're navigating city streets or embarking on a road trip, the Astra delivers a dependable and enjoyable driving experience.
